The room is nice and clean. The surrounding area is also nice. Park city has free bus service and there is a bus stop right across the street from the building

Great place for the price, it was clean and nice. The only reason that I've given it a 4 star is there is no check in desk. Check in is all done over the phone, which is a difficult process because we had to wait for the line to become free many times just to have simple questions like what the WiFi password was or where we could park.

I stayed in one of the more recently renovated rooms. It was nicer then I expected! Only hickup was with check-in. Apparently there isn't a front desk and you need a code for the front door. I couldn't find the code in my email. But they have a phone number to call and the lady helped me out and got everything squared away. Will stay again.
